Using virtual reality to tell brand stories

Ahn, Sun Joo (Grace), Beharry, C., Hanus, M., King, K., & Rich, J. (panelists in alphabetical order, 2017). Using virtual reality to tell brand stories: The state of the art and future directions. Panel discussion to take place at the American Academy of Advertising Conference, March 23-26, 2017, Boston, MA.

Abstract: This proposed special session aims to discuss the state of the art in using virtual environment technologies to tell compelling brand stories and explore how these developments impact how consumers produce and consume information. The session will combine up-to-date findings from academic researchers on virtual worlds with action plans and visions for the future presented by both an advertising agency executive who heads a future experiences lab at a leading Publicis advertising agency and a producer whose media outlet is a leader in brand storytelling in the virtual space. This panel will suggest recommendations for future directions in brand storytelling using these emerging technologies.
